python
对csv文件中每列数据进行归一化代码:
#对数据归一化处理 #导入数据 import numpy as np import matplotlib.pyplot as plt import pandas as pd # df = pd.read_excel('D:\\零时文件\\data.csv',usecols=[0,1,2,3,4,5,6,7,8,9,10]) df = pd.read_csv('D:/desk/set/datasetfinnew.csv') # 最值归一化 from sklearn.preprocessing import MinMaxScaler scaler = MinMaxScaler() scaler.fit(df) scaled_features = scaler.transform(df) df_MinMax = pd.DataFrame(data=scaled_features) df_MinMax.to_csv('D:/desk/set/datareadin.csv')#存储到CSV中